The British Insurance Brokers' Association has launched a medical malpractice scheme for its members in collaboration with FSJ, the UK wholesale arm of broker Heath Lambert.
The scheme offers no minimum premium restrictions, meaning that brokers of any size can place business through the scheme. There is no Aids exclusion, while breach of confidentiality cover is included as standard and nurses benefit from indemnity.
